5.5 Replacing air lter
Fig. 5.6 Changing drive belt
The air lter (1) is attached to the
compressor’s intake valve.
In order to replace it, open the left side
panel, loosen the clamp (2) securing the
lter. Remove the contaminated lter, and
detach the clamp from it.
Set the new lter in its place and t into
place with the clamp.
5.6 Changing drive belt
Open the left side panel, loosen the 4
screws (3) securing the bracket of the air
end by turning them 2 revolutions.
Loosen the 2 bolts of the motor (2) and the
2 corresponding nuts (1) on the tensioner
using a wrench. Remove the old belts from
the pulleys and install the new belts.
After installing the new belt, tighten the
belt with the appropriate tensile force
(see section 5.3 Checking Drive Belt).
Tighten the 2 bolts of the motor (2) and
the 2 corresponding nuts on the tensio-
ner. Tighten the 4 screws of the brak-
ket of the air end. Check the belt tensi-
on within four hours of the compressor’s
operation in accordance with section 5.3.
